Byla vydána (𝕏) dubnová aktualizace aneb nová verze 1.100 editoru zdrojových kódů Visual Studio Code (Wikipedie). Přehled novinek i s náhledy a videi v poznámkách k vydání. Ve verzi 1.100 vyjde také VSCodium, tj. komunitní sestavení Visual Studia Code bez telemetrie a licenčních podmínek Microsoftu.
Open source platforma Home Assistant (Demo, GitHub, Wikipedie) pro monitorování a řízení inteligentní domácnosti byla vydána v nové verzi 2025.5.
OpenSearch (Wikipedie) byl vydán ve verzi 3.0. Podrobnosti v poznámkách k vydání. Jedná se o fork projektů Elasticsearch a Kibana.
PyXL je koncept procesora, ktorý dokáže priamo spúštat Python kód bez nutnosti prekladu ci Micropythonu. Podľa testov autora je pri 100 MHz približne 30x rýchlejší pri riadeni GPIO nez Micropython na Pyboard taktovanej na 168 MHz.
Grafana (Wikipedie), tj. open source nástroj pro vizualizaci různých metrik a s ní související dotazování, upozorňování a lepší porozumění, byla vydána ve verzi 12.0. Přehled novinek v aktualizované dokumentaci.
Raspberry Pi OS, oficiální operační systém pro Raspberry Pi, byl vydán v nové verzi 2025-05-06. Přehled novinek v příspěvku na blogu Raspberry Pi a poznámkách k vydání. Pravděpodobně se jedná o poslední verzi postavenou na Debianu 12 Bookworm. Následující verze by již měla být postavena na Debianu 13 Trixie.
Richard Stallman dnes v Liberci přednáší o svobodném softwaru a svobodě v digitální společnosti. Od 16:30 v aule budovy G na Technické univerzitě v Liberci. V anglickém jazyce s automaticky generovanými českými titulky. Vstup je zdarma i pro širokou veřejnost.
sudo-rs, tj. sudo a su přepsáné do programovacího jazyka Rust, nahradí v Ubuntu 25.10 klasické sudo. V plánu je také přechod od klasických coreutils k uutils coreutils napsaných v Rustu.
Fedora se stala oficiální distribucí WSL (Windows Subsystem for Linux).
Společnost IBM představila server IBM LinuxONE Emperor 5 poháněný procesorem IBM Telum II.
Kromě další nestabilní verze živého CD Elive 0.6.7 a Pioneer Rifleman Alpha 3 přišel na svět Linux Mint 2.2 v malé i velké KDE edici. Dánští vývojáři distribuce pro kancelářské prostředí představili Nonux 4.2 a Skolelinux (neboli Debian-Edu) vyšel ve verzi 3.0 na jednom DVD. Pro hudebníky je tu první release candidate Musix GNU+Linux 1.0 argentinského původu. A na závěr VectorLinux 5.8 RC3 SOHO edice s doladěnou podporou proprietárních grafických ovladačů a miniaturní živé CD Slackware pojmenované NimbleX 2007v2.
Administrace Bundestagu podle Heise Online zareagovala na kritiku ze strany Linux Association. Linux Association kritizuje to, že v případě nového pilotního IT projektu neproběhly žádné veřejné tendry. Současnou svobodnou e-mailovou architekturu by tak měl začít doplňovat Microsoft Exchange. Podle LA toto podkopává open source strategii a zavání to ovlivňováním ze stran komerčních společností. Dle mluvčího Clause Hinterleitnera je vše v pořádku: podmínky pro neveřejný tendr byly splněny a licence pro pilotní projekt byly získány na základě stávajících dohod. Hinterleitner zdůraznil, že pilotní projekt neznamená zavržení open source strategie. Někteří členové Linux Association nejsou s vysvětlením spokojeni a chtějí, aby právníci celou věc prošetřili.
Eben Moglen ve svém blogu píše o práci na GNU GPLv3 a své budoucnosti. Je spokojen s odezvou na GPLv3 - nesouhlasy a křik byly podle něj slyšet především ze strany Microsoftu a jeho společníků, což znamená, že vše je tak, jak má být. Sice se na Internetu objevují zprávy o tom, kdo GPLv3 odmítá a rozhodně ji nebude používat, ale Eben Moglen se sám setkal s mnoha lidmi, kteří o tuto připravovanou licenci mají zájem. GPLv3 mu však bere všechen čas vyhrazený práci, někdy dokonce veškerý čas. Proto už se nemůže dočkat, až bude vše hotové. Především tedy chce opustit komisi FSF, ve které byl od roku 2000. Chce se vrátit ke svému zaměstnání učitele a část svého času hodlá věnovat společnosti Software Freedom Law Center.
Už nějakou dobu funguje systém PCLinuxOS Hardware Database, který od uživatelů shromažďuje informace o funkčním hardwaru. Nyní se plánuje zahájení programu, ve kterém by výrobci počítačů mohli dostávat certifikáty kompatibility. Modely počítačů budou vždy otestovány na poslední verzi PCLinuxOS a budou moci nést označení „Certified -- Works with PCLinuxOS“. Certifikační tým bude nejprve testovat počítače, aniž by výrobce projevil zájem - výrobci budou pouze oznámeny výsledky. Přesné požadavky pro certifikát ještě nebyly oznámeny, ale předběžně lze říci, že hardware bude muset fungovat bez speciálních zásahů uživatele a bude muset dosahovat výkonu, jaký je od produktu očekáván. Certifikáty budou mít dvě úrovně: stříbrnou a zlatou. Stříbrná bude sloužit pro hardware, který je sice podporován, nicméně výrobce o certifikát neprojevuje zájem. Zlatá je vyhrazena výrobcům, kteří prokáží dostatečný zájem o podporu Linuxu distribucí potřebných ovladačů a úsilím o udržení kompatibility.
Jeremiah Summers, zakladatel hardwarové databáze PCLinuxOS, věří, že stříbrné certifikáty jsou šancí pro rozšíření povědomí o Linuxu. Doufá, že získání certifikátu výrobce dostatečně překvapí: „Zdá se, že je to nezajímá. Musíme jim ukázat náš zájem a to, že jim můžeme pomoci. Tak dokážeme, že ať se jim to líbí nebo ne, tak jejich hardware funguje. ‚Můžete nás nadále ignorovat nebo můžete využít předností vašeho již funkčního hardwaru a příště můžete účelově říci: Použili jsme tento čip, protože je kompatibilní s Linuxem‘.“
Ghanská vláda to se svobodným a open source softwarem myslí opravdu vážně, což dokázal Mike Oquaye (ministr komunikací) svou řečí na FLOSS konferenci v hlavním městě Accra. Centru Kofiho Annana (Kofi Annan Centre of Excellence in ICT) už zadal úkol, aby vedlo proces vývoje národní open source politiky a připravilo návrh pro posouzení. Poznamenal také, že ghanští zákonodárci už Linux používají - pro Ghanu je FLOSS důležitý, protože snižuje náklady a umožňuje vládě, aby si zachovala svou vlastní technologii. „Naše rozhodnutí investovat do rozvoje našich znalostí open source řešení je částečně podobné rozhodnutí stát se nezávislým státem před 50 lety. Opět zde vidíme problém centrálního vlastnictví a moci. My chceme vlastnit technologii, kterou používáme. Chceme mít do určité míry možnost kontroly nad našimi technologickými volbami.“
Švédská firma MySQL AB je jednou z největších open source společností na světě. Obzvlášť poslední dobou se jí dobře daří; za minulý rok totiž dosáhla příjmu 50 milionů dolarů, přičemž v roce 2005 to bylo 34 milionů a v roce 2002 pouze 6,5 milionu. Nyní se připravuje změna: MySQL AB se stane akciovou společností. Marten Mickos, výkonný ředitel společnosti, řekl, že tím se odstraní jedna z překážek obchodu s některými konzervativními zákazníky - ti totiž chtějí obchodovat pouze s akciovými společnostmi. MySQL má nyní na trhu mnoho konkurentů, a to open source i closed source. Mickos se konkrétně zmínil o Oracle: „Nechceme Oraclu sníst oběd. Chceme jim sníst dezert. Velmi rádi s nimi soupeříme a bereme jim zákazníky. Zároveň však nechceme spadnout do strategie Davida a Goliáše, kde všichni křičí ‚Jdi, MySQL, jdi! Zabij Oracle!‘ Znám jedno čínské rčení: pokud se soustředíš na jednoho soupeře, nakonec budeš jako on - a to my nechceme.“
Real Time Linux bude zákazníkům Red Hatu k dispozici dříve, než se původně plánovalo. Tomu však v tomto případě nebude předcházet zařazení do Fedory. Důvodem je to, že se Red Hat snaží všechny podrobnosti utajit. Real-time patche se budou do vanilla jádra dostávat pouze postupně a za rok tam budou všechny - poté bude mít smysl, aby existovala real-time iniciativa i u Fedory. To řekl Tim Burke, vedoucí oddělení nově vznikajících technologií v Red Hatu, a dodal: „Naším původním plánem bylo dostat všechny funkce nejprve do vanilla jádra a pak vše integrovat do Red Hat Enterprise Linuxu 6. Zákazníci na nás však tlačí, takže nebudeme čekat dalších 18 měsíců. Naším současným záměrem je nabídnout real-time jádro ve značném předstihu před RHEL 6.“ Kód už je prý hotový a je testován ve spolupráci s partnery a zákazníky. Informace pocházejí ze článku serveru internetnews.com.
Polská distribuce KateOS přichází s verzí 3.6 beta ve formě instalovatelného živého CD a instalačního DVD. Od verze 3.2 byl učiněn velký pokrok týkající se přehledu nad systémovými službami, kvality bootovacích skriptů nebo jednoduchosti použití instalátoru. Tato betaverze má lepší podporu produktů značky Hewlett-Packard a už ve výchozím stavu můžete používat Software Suspend 2. Vylepšení se dotýkají i grafických konfiguračních nástrojů, například konfigurace sítě a firewallu. A co v této betaverzi dále naleznete? Jádro 2.6.19.3 s nabídkou tří grafických prostředí: KDE 3.5.6, GNOME 2.18.1 a Xfce 4.4.1. Dále kompletní balík OpenOffice.org 2.2, Mozillu Firefox, Mozillu Thunderbird, Nmap 4.20, multimediální výzbroj v podobě xine 0.99.4, MPlayer 1.0pre8, Audacious 1.3.1 a další programy.
Před několika dny vyšlo živé CD Berry Linux 0.80, které je založené na Fedoře. Z jazyků podporuje angličtinu a japonštinu. Používá jádro verze 2.6.20.7 s podporou SMP, ndev/udev a patche pro bootsplash. Pro hardwarovou detekci slouží Fedora Kudzu 1.2.67 a hwdata 0.199 od Klause Knoppera. Berry Linux je distribuován s X.org 7.1, včetně AIGLX, a Berylu 0.2.0. Obsahuje mj. OpenOffice.org 2.2.0, Mozillu Firefox 1.5.0.11 a e-mailového klienta Sylpheed 2.3.1 – tento software v angličtině i japonštině. Více čtěte v kompletním changelogu.
Poslední novou verzí distribuce, na kterou se dnes podíváme, je PUD GNU/Linux 0.4.7. Stejně jako předchozí je to distribuce exotická, ale PUD GNU/Linux kromě tradiční a zjednodušené čínštiny podporuje i jazyk anglický. Občas se při běhu anglického prostředí můžete setkat s problémy nebo chybami, obecně se však dá říci, že to není nijak zlé. Aktuální PUD GNU/Linux je založený na balíčcích z Ubuntu 7.04. Používá Aufs spolu se SquashFS, do kterého byla přidána podpora komprese LZMA. Na živém CD naleznete základní softwarovou výbavu, tzn. VLC Media Player, Beep-Media-Player, GQView, Gaim, gFTP, aMule, gVim a mimo jiné i grafický nástroj ndisgtk pro instalaci WiFi ovladačů pro Windows. Tento systém má výslednou velikost 194 MB.
V minulém dílu Distribučních novinek jsme se podívali na nástroj Woof pro snadný přenos souborů přes síť. Tentokrát se můžete naučit některé základní operace se socat. Socat je univerzální nástroj pro přenos dat přes síť, roury a jiná zařízení. Vyzkoušíme si jednoduchý přenos souboru - na straně příjemce spusťte tento příkaz:
socat TCP-LISTEN:1234 soubor.dat
Program bude čekat na spojení na TCP portu 1234 a obsah spojení uloží do souboru soubor.dat
. Na straně odesílající tedy můžeme spustit
socat TCP:IP_ADRESA:1234 nejakysoubor.dat
Socat bude takto fungovat jako TCP klient: připojí se na IP_ADRESA na port 1234 a přenese soubor nazvaný nejakysoubor.dat
. S Woof jsme mohli před přenosem adresáře jeho obsah zkomprimovat pomocí gzip - toho lze dosáhnout i se socatem. Na klientské straně spustíme tento příkaz:
tar -czf - /home/nejaky/adresar | socat TCP:IP_ADRESA:1234 -
a na naslouchající (serverové) straně použijeme toto:
socat TCP-LISTEN:1234 - | tar -xzf - -C /kam/ulozit
Samostatná pomlčka u socatu i taru znamená, že se nečte/nezapisuje do souboru, ale do roury. Socat lze využít i k přímé komunikaci s nějakým serverem v síti. Výhodou je možnost použití SSL šifrování nebo tunelování skrze SOCKS proxy. Mnoho ukázek použití naleznete v manuálu, zde je ukázka SSL spojení k poštovnímu IMAP serveru:
socat SSL:mail.nekde.cz:993 -
Na závěr si ještě ukážeme přesměrovávání portů. Veškerá příchozí TCP spojení na port 8011 se nyní přesměrují na port 8010 na jiný počítač:
socat TCP-LISTEN:8011,fork TCP:JINÝ_POČÍTAČ:8010
Nástroje: Tisk bez diskuse
Tiskni
Sdílej:
nc -l -p 8011 -c 'nc target_ip 8010'iked je pravda, ze to nie je presmerovanie konekcie, ale len dat co prichadzaju na port 8011. V kazdom pripade casto postacujuci tunel :)
Nepozeral som socat este, ale z toho co sa tu pise mi nie je jasne preco je spominany ked mame netcatNo pravda, proč já vlastně vůbec zmiňuju nějaké Xfce, když přece máme GNOME